> > > v3:
> > >  - Kees Cook pointed out a weird side-effect: devices which have
> > >    ->init() registered get their randomness added to the system each
> > >    time they're switched in, but devices that don't have the init
> > >    callback don't contribute to system randomness more than once.  The
> > >    weirdness is resolved here by using the randomness each time
> > >    hwrng_init() is attempted, irrespective of the existence of the
> > >    device's ->init() callback.
